IDEA 2025.2又整大活!AI 助手脱胎换骨,Spring 调试一秒看透,连 Java 25 和虚拟线程都安排上了!

大家好,这里是架构资源栈 !点击上方关注,添加"星标",一起学习大厂前沿架构!

关注、发送C1即可获取JetBrains全家桶激活工具和码!

前言

大家都知道小D一直在做JetBrains系列软件的内容,不管是免费的还是付费的都在一直做,都是很持久的!

JetBrains 在 2025.2 版本的 IntelliJ IDEA 上再次放出"大招",不仅在 AI 能力上实现质变,连 Spring、Java、Maven、Bazel 等主流技术栈都迎来了升级级的支持。不夸张地说,这一波更新是对开发效率、体验和工具链整合的"全线重塑"! 让我们来一探究竟,这次 IDEA 到底卷出了什么新高度👇


🧠 AI 助手大升级:离线补全 + 项目上下文 + MCP 全面支持!

JetBrains 在 AI 工具方面持续加码,AI Assistant 和 Junie 正式迎来超级增强:

  • AI 补全支持更多语言: JSON、YAML、Markdown、SQL 全都支持了,编辑文档也能飞快。
  • 离线模式支持 Java 补全: 在无网、封闭企业内网、飞机上照样能用,甚至还能切换本地模型,灵活又高效。
  • 性能提升: Junie 现在快了 30%,还支持远程环境,部署到云端也稳得住。
  • 项目级 AI 指令: 通过 _Project Rules_ 文件自定义项目约束,比如代码风格或框架约定,AI 再也不会"跑偏"。
  • AUTO 模式选择模型: IDEA 自动帮你选最佳模型,既省心又能控制成本。

🖼️ 图示功能:


💬 AI 聊天更懂你:结构、图像、文件都能用!

新功能简直就是"AI 理解上下文的里程碑":

  • 表和视图上下文可附加: AI 会根据数据库结构给出更贴合实际的建议,尤其适合大型企业系统。
  • 图像支持: 错误截图、图表可直接发给 AI,无需描述,现已兼容 OpenAI 和 Anthropic。
  • 多文件上下文引入: 使用 @ 或 # 添加文件夹或文件,适合复杂模块间分析与辅助。

🖼️ 示例:


🌐 MCP:让你的 AI 工作流真正自动化

AI 只是"聪明",MCP 才是"系统化"的开始:

  • Junie 支持 Model Context Protocol,上下文理解提升,任务处理能力更强。
  • IntelliJ IDEA 现在可作为第三方智能体的 MCP 服务端,直接暴露 IDE 功能供调用。
  • 内建 30+ 工具,可实现 自动重构、搜索、调试 等操作。

🔗 了解详情链接:www.jetbrains.com/zh-cn/help/...


☕ Java 25 全面支持,抢先布局 LTS!

对于打算从 Java 11、17 或 21 升级的团队来说,IDEA 这次直接打通 Java 25 的"通天大道":

  • 支持 Java 25 正式版 + 所有预览功能
  • 可在 IDE 内直接下载体验
  • 无缝集成,过渡轻松

🐣 Spring Boot 开发者的福音:调试器彻底进化!

Spring 调试器插件上线,彻底颠覆传统调试体验:

  • 可实时查看加载 Bean
  • 支持查看配置值来源(环境变量、配置文件等)
  • 实时监控数据库连接与事务状态
  • 零配置,安装插件即可使用!

🔗 博客详解:blog.jetbrains.com/idea/2025/0...


🧱 Spring Modulith 支持:更容易构建模块化架构

DDD 开发者狂喜!IDEA 现在原生支持 Spring Modulith:

  • 自动识别模块依赖
  • 跨模块 Bean 报警提示
  • 新增逻辑结构视图,一目了然查看系统模块关系

这让事件驱动架构和模块化开发更易落地。


🔧 Maven 4 支持 + Bazel 原生集成:未来构建方式一网打尽

构建工具这块也迎来了质的飞跃:

  • Maven 4: 候选版本已支持,语法高亮、导航、同步都稳定。
  • Bazel: 官方插件正式版发布,支持 Java/Kotlin/Python/Go,跨平台性能佳、体验流畅。

🔗 Bazel 官方说明:blog.jetbrains.com/idea/2025/0...


🧵 虚拟线程调试:并发分析终于"有眼可见"

Java 的虚拟线程(来自 JDK 21+)现在可以:

  • 查看每个虚拟线程锁住的对象
  • 自动分组相同堆栈,避免视图泛滥
  • 支持导入 jstackjcmd 数据,分析更灵活

🖼️ 图示:


🧬 Scala 新特性 + sbt 模块优化

Scala 插件同步更新:

  • 支持 Scala 3 不透明类型、新元组操作(zip、concat 等)
  • sbt 模块结构默认启用新版布局
  • 自动生成 sbt 管理的源文件,避免"红色代码"

🔗 Scala 更新博客:blog.jetbrains.com/scala/2025/...


🧰 数据库体验提升:SELECT JOIN 可直接编辑!

数据库操作更轻松:

  • 现在 SELECT 带 JOIN 语句的查询也支持网格直接编辑,无需手写 UPDATE
  • 大幅提升数据处理效率!

🖼️ 示例:


🌐 Web 开发者请注意:Bun 支持、TypeScript 更快了!

Web 开发体验优化:

  • 实验性支持 TypeScript-Go LSP, 补全更智能
  • Web Platform Baseline 数据整合,快速查看 API 支持情况
  • 自动识别并配置 Bun, 减少环境设置工作量

✅ JSpecify 正式支持:null 安全性跃升!

随着 JSpecify 1.0 的发布,IntelliJ IDEA 也将其标记为一等注解:

  • IntelliJ 可分析 null 安全问题,包括集合、泛型等复杂场景
  • Kotlin 也会尊重 JSpecify 注解,提升跨语言安全性

🔗 Spring 中的实践:spring.io/blog/2025/0...


🎁 Ultimate 订阅到期也不慌,Java & Kotlin 还能继续用

就算订阅暂时中断,IDE 也不会"一刀切":

  • Java 与 Kotlin 的核心功能仍可使用
  • 开发不中断,工作不掉链

安装

小D推荐使用JetBrains官方的JetBrains ToolBox软件进行安装/更新,非常方便,一键即可安装。

需要哪里点哪里,再也不用那些繁琐的安装步骤了,官方的管理软件对软件和插件版本校验适配更好,非常推荐。

对着软件陌生的同学可以看这一篇文章:

我极力推荐你用这个软件来管理JetBrains!

旗舰版

参见原文


🚀 小结:开发者必升级的一次大版本!

无论你是后端 Java 稳扎稳打,还是搞前端 Vue + Bun 的"潮人",这次的 IntelliJ IDEA 2025.2 更新都给你安排得明明白白!

不管是 AI 智能化、Spring 深度支持、构建工具现代化,还是调试器的革新------它不只是 IDE 更新,而是 生产力的再定义

👉 快去更新试试看吧:www.jetbrains.com/zh-cn/idea/...


喜欢这类更新解析,记得关注公【架构资源栈】,免费获取激活工具包和码!

欢迎留言分享你对 IntelliJ IDEA 2025.2 的看法~


原文地址:mp.weixin.qq.com/s/9k3vebyN8...


喜欢就奖励一个"👍"和"在看"呗~

本文由博客一文多发平台 OpenWrite 发布!

相关推荐
保加利亚的风几秒前
【Java】使用FreeMarker来实现Word自定义导出
java·word
SteveCode.4 分钟前
SpringBoot 2.x 升 3.x 避坑指南:企业级项目的实战问题与解决方案
java·spring boot
Yang-Never14 分钟前
Kotlin -> object声明和object表达式
android·java·开发语言·kotlin·android studio
风萧萧199915 分钟前
Java 实现poi方式读取word文件内容
java·开发语言·word
喵手25 分钟前
如何实现一个简单的基于Spring Boot的用户权限管理系统?
java·spring boot·后端
C4程序员1 小时前
北京JAVA基础面试30天打卡01
java·开发语言·面试
Aczone281 小时前
数据结构(三)双向链表
java·数据结构·链表
菜菜的后端私房菜1 小时前
Dubbo2到Dubbo3服务发现机制的优化
java·后端·dubbo
33255_40857_280591 小时前
RocketMQ实战指南:Java开发者的分布式消息中间件全解析
java·rocketmq
Seven971 小时前
剑指offer-19、顺时针打印矩阵
java